Sylvia Jean Baker, 79, formerly of Duncansville, passed away Saturday at Garvey Manor Nursing Home, Hollidaysburg.

She was born in Duncansville, daughter of the late Raymond L. and Lillian (Berney) Baker.

Surviving are a brother, Harry (DyAnn); four nieces: Patsy Fownes and husband, Rick, Diane Weyant Kline, Charlotte Miles and Donna Pattison; six nephews: Doug Weyant and Mike, David, Greg, Steve and Bill Baker; a special great-niece, Delaney; and two special great-nephews: H.T. and Matthew.

She was preceded in death by two sisters: Edna Baker and Lois Baker Weyant; a brother, Robert; a twin to Harry.

Sylvia was an Avon sales rep in Duncansville for 19 years. She also was a baby sitter for many children in the area.

She was a member of St. Michael the Archangel Catholic Church, Hollidaysburg, and a former member of Hicks Memorial Methodist Church, Duncansville.

Sylvia was an animal lover. She also enjoyed baking and making fudge.
